FRANCE.
It is rumoured that the Government propose sending 10,000 troops to Mexico to crush Juarez ; but it is also reported that Seward has sent a despatch to the French Government, stating that the United States cannot recognise the Emperor Maximilian either now or in the future. It also declares that the Monroe doctrine is adopted as their foreign policy by the Washington Government. The French and English iron-clad fleets are to visit the coasts of both countries, and then to assemble at Plymouth, at the suggestion of Napoleon.
